Water Temperature Ranges in Piscataway by Month

January

MinimumAverageMaximum
34°F41°F48°F

February

MinimumAverageMaximum
34°F41°F48°F

March

MinimumAverageMaximum
37°F44°F52°F

April

MinimumAverageMaximum
41°F50°F61°F

May

MinimumAverageMaximum
46°F56°F70°F

June

MinimumAverageMaximum
57°F65°F72°F

July

MinimumAverageMaximum
63°F68°F75°F

August

MinimumAverageMaximum
63°F71°F73°F

September

MinimumAverageMaximum
52°F64°F66°F

October

MinimumAverageMaximum
46°F56°F61°F

November

MinimumAverageMaximum
37°F47°F61°F

December

MinimumAverageMaximum
37°F40°F46°F

Water Temperature in Piscataway: General Trends and Swimming Opportunities

Piscataway, New Jersey, is situated along the Raritan River, a key waterway in the area. The water temperature in this section of the river varies throughout the year. During the summer months, temperatures typically range from 70°F to 80°F (21°C to 27°C), making it appear to be a good temperature for swimming. However, despite the relatively warm water in the warmer months, the Raritan River is not considered a safe location for recreational swimming due to a variety of factors.

The Raritan River near Piscataway often has strong currents and water quality concerns, which can make swimming dangerous. The presence of industrial activity, boat traffic, and runoff from surrounding urban areas can negatively affect water quality, with occasional contamination making it unsafe for swimmers. Additionally, the river's unpredictable currents and depth changes can pose risks to anyone attempting to swim in its waters.

As a result, swimming in the Raritan River in Piscataway is not recommended. Those seeking a safer and more controlled swimming experience are encouraged to use local pools or designated recreational areas in the area. These provide a safer and more enjoyable alternative to the river, with maintained facilities that ensure cleaner and calmer water for swimming.
